Biography: Two-year starter who posted 41 tackles/2.5 tackles for loss/2 sacks as a senior after posting 52/5/1.5 the prior year.
Positives: Undersized college defensive lineman who gets the most from his skill. Plays with good pad level, gets leverage on opponents and keeps his feet driving up the field. Quickly changes direction, chases the action and stays with plays. Works his hands to protect himself. Negatives: Lacks great first-step quickness. Undersized and easily neutralized at the point of attack. Possesses just a short burst and cannot pursue the action out to the sidelines. Analysis: Peters was a hardworking defensive lineman on the college level, but he lacks the physical skills to be anything other than a backup in the NFL. He could get consideration as a three-technique tackle if he improves his playing strength. Projection: FA |
